Transaction c233a79a248fd7903b3bb70e52ab37af76bcd3084edafc30cc4d521888e35be0

3 Input
2 Outputs
  • c233a79a248fd7903b3bb70e52ab37af76bcd3084edafc30cc4d521888e35be0:0
  • value  20000000
    address  3FtYicivtEPZoHScuSNA4JTeWhcDiKLD5H
  • c233a79a248fd7903b3bb70e52ab37af76bcd3084edafc30cc4d521888e35be0:1
  • value  20361450
    address  3BMEXu6ozENrv7i52zRtfJB72o85hgsefM